Purpose
1. Automate and streamline user account provisioning and deactivation across IT systems for the outboard motor retail sector.
2. Automate secure onboarding and offboarding, reducing manual errors, ensuring compliance, and cutting operational delays.
3. Synchronize user states between HR, POS, inventory, email, and device management platforms.
4. Enforce access rights automation to sensitive marine equipment data and financial records.
5. Optimize workforce transitions with automated detection, approval workflows, and record archiving in the marine retail domain.
Trigger Conditions
1. Automatedly triggered on new employee hire in HRMS or termination event in payroll system.
2. Automation on user role change in directory or department transfer.
3. Automate account suspension after IT security incident.
4. Scheduled audits automatically identifying inactive users for deactivation.
5. Ticket submission in ITSM tools automates workflow initiation.
Platform Variants
1. Microsoft Azure Active Directory
- Feature/Setting: User lifecycle API — Automate user create, update, and delete using Microsoft Graph API `/users` endpoint.
2. Google Workspace
- Feature/Setting: Admin SDK Directory API for automated user account add/remove `/admin/directory/v1/users`.
3. Okta
- Feature/Setting: Lifecycle Management — Automate provisioning and deprovisioning via Okta Events API and SCIM connectors.
4. OneLogin
- Feature/Setting: Automated User Provisioning (SCIM) — Configure real-time user creation/deactivation with Users API endpoint `/api/1/users`.
5. JumpCloud
- Feature/Setting: Directory Insights — Set automation to disable or delete accounts via `/api/systemusers/` actions.
6. AWS IAM
- Feature/Setting: Automate AWS Lambda function triggers for IAM user creation or deletion via Boto3 SDK.
7. ServiceNow
- Feature/Setting: Flow Designer automates user onboarding/offboarding using ServiceNow Table APIs.
8. Atlassian (Jira/Confluence)
- Feature/Setting: REST API automates user addition/removal endpoints `/rest/api/2/user`.
9. Slack
- Feature/Setting: SCIM API — Automate user provisioning with `/scim/v1/Users` for creating or deactivating users.
10. Salesforce
- Feature/Setting: User Management API automates creation and deactivation via `/services/data/vXX.X/sobjects/User/`.
11. Zendesk
- Feature/Setting: Users API — Automate end-user and agent add/remove via `/api/v2/users.json`.
12. Freshservice
- Feature/Setting: Orchestration center automates user lifecycle using `/api/v2/requesters` endpoint.
13. Dropbox Business
- Feature/Setting: Team API automates user join/disable via `team/members/add/remove`.
14. Box
- Feature/Setting: Automated account add/remove using Users API `/users` endpoint.
15. HubSpot
- Feature/Setting: User Provisioning API automates creation/deletion events.
16. Zoom
- Feature/Setting: Automated user provisioning via `/v2/users` API for instant activation or deactivation.
17. GitHub Enterprise
- Feature/Setting: REST API for automated invitation and removal of organization members `/orgs/{org}/memberships/{username}`.
18. Shopify
- Feature/Setting: Storefront Admin API automates staff account lifecycle `/admin/api/2023-04/users.json`.
19. NetSuite
- Feature/Setting: REST API automates user roles assignment and removal `/record/v1/user`.
20. Cisco Meraki
- Feature/Setting: Dashboard API automates user device access provisioning or removal `/networks/:networkId/users`.
21. Workday
- Feature/Setting: Human Resources API automates onboarding/offboarding linked to system accounts.
22. BambooHR
- Feature/Setting: Automation rules on employee status changes trigger webhook/integration for account management.
23. Duo Security
- Feature/Setting: Admin API automates user enrollments or deletions `/admin/v1/users`.
24. Trello
- Feature/Setting: API automates board membership via `/1/members/{id}`.
Benefits
1. Automates retail IT compliance by ensuring the right users access the right marine sales data.
2. Reduces onboarding/offboarding time from days to minutes via automation.
3. Increases security by automating timely revocation of former staff access.
4. Minimizes risk of unauthorized data access by automating user state synchronization.
5. Cuts manual IT workload, freeing team for higher-value automation initiatives.
6. Centralizes user lifecycle audit logs for compliance and automation traceability.
7. Supports scalability of outboard motor store operations through automated user management as business grows.